Yes, you can dye "real" feathers (fake ones don't really work very well). We usually buy light coloured ones if we are dying them bright colours. The best way I know of to attach feathers (without getting in to complicated wig-making techniques) is to carefully hot glue them on.

There are tons of different ways to make wigs, from "quick and dirty" methods up to the techniques pro wig makers use. The technique you use really depends on the design of the puppet, what materials you have available and how much time you are willing (or able) to spend on it.

I've personally found that hot glue works well, although you have to be careful not to drip any accidently on your puppet's "skin" and there is always the chance the feathers could loosen if you use it for long periods of time under very hot lights.

A good way to get more ideas for yourself would be to look up wig making books or books on theatrical make-up techniques on amazon.com or at your local library.
